CLUTCHES, BRAKES & COUPLINGS FEATURE SAFETY BRAKES MEET NEW EU ELEVATOR DIRECTIVE


As of 20th April, the new 2014/33/EU Directive came into force, replacing the 95/16/EC Directive. Within this, the Standards EN 81-20 and EN 81-50 have been developed to improve the safety of elevators in the EU, replacing EN 81-1 and EN 81-2 as of 1st September 2017. The new EN 81-20 standard refers to the specifications for the design of elevators and technical characteristics. EN 81-50 regulates how the inspection of elevators and individual components must be implemented, with one aspect placing further requirements on the prototype inspection of the braking equipment as part of the ascending car overspeed protection means (ACOP) and against unintended car movement (UCM).


According to mayr power transmission, it was the first manufacturer to provide safety brakes on the basis of this new standard, ensuring its elevator brakes fulfil the increased safety specifications contained in these latest standards. All mayr safety brakes are subject to careful quality controls. Therefore, prior


to delivery, all brakes are extensively tested on calibrated test stands and function-relevant values are documented. An electronic database in which the measurement values together with the associated serial numbers of a product are stored ensures 100% traceability in the process. The company’s brakes are designed so that they reliably achieve the


required nominal torque under all occurring operating conditions, irrespective of ambient temperature or humidity, for example. In addition, the brakes are equipped with a patented noise damping system. On noise-optimised designs, switching noises are practically non-existent and lie below 50 dB(A) (acoustic pressure level measurement) in new condition, the company explains.


Mayr www.mayr.com BRAKE MOTORS WITH A RANGE OF OPTIONS


Emerson Industrial Automation has introduced a new range of Leroy-Somer FFB brake motors. This has been developed around the ‘flexible concept’ which offers an extensive range of options associated with safety and variable speed as standard. With the latest generation IMfinity induction motor from Emerson, the FFB brake motor is designed to withstand the most severe stresses encountered in handling applications. The brake motor can be integrated in most fixed or variable speed applications quickly and easily. In


addition, its modular encoder adaptation principle makes it a versatile motor, suitable for the simplest to the most demanding variable speed applications. This new range, sized for dynamic braking, is based on failsafe


operation. The industrial control of its performance (running-in of all the friction parts as standard) and a wide range of braking function supervision accessories (opening, closing and wear sensor, etc.), significantly increase the safety of the transmission chain. FFB brake motors offer various different efficiency levels: non-IE, IE2 and IE3.

COUPLINGS FOR


MOBILE PLANT Delta flywheel couplings from Guardian Couplings are now available from Huco Dynatork. The range delivers smooth power transmission with reduced noise and vibration, for diesel driven hydrostatic machinery including forklifts, agricultural vehicles and off-highway plant equipment. The couplings are easy to install,


using a single-piece design which incorporates a hardened steel hub that is pre-assembled into a glass-fibre reinforced flange. The coupling attaches to the engine flywheel, taking advantage of elastomeric grommets that provide a steady dampening effect, protecting against normal engine vibrations and shock loading. While the couplings are suited to accurately aligned drives, they are able to accommodate the small angular, parallel and axial misalignments which are typical to piloted flange connections. They have been designed for long term reliability in demanding applications with the latest tier engines, and are able to transmit a nominal torque of up to 693Nm and a maximum torque of 1,730Nm. The hubs can be specified with a straight bore and keyway with set screw retention for straight pump shaft demands, or with a spline shaft connection. Of additional benefit, the


range has an operating temperature window ranging from 40˚C to 100˚C.
